Handover for the sync: Largeview diff viewer. Chunked rendering for files over 50MB is merged and behind a flag. Known issue: syntax highlighting stalls on minified JS over 200k lines — workaround is plaintext fallback, already wired. Marta owns the virtual-scroll rewrite next sprint; I finished the memory-cap work. Perf numbers are in the Brightfen dashboard. Nothing blocking release. To reproduce my benchmark environment exactly, start the viewer service with the config below.

deployment values, faduf-tawep:
SORDOR_LOG_LEVEL=error
SORDOR_METRICS_HOST=metrics.sordor.nelvrolabs.internal
SORDOR_POOL_SIZE=4

## Limits: Tindervane token refresh

Quick context for review: the refresh bug in Tindervane fired because we let refreshes stack during clock skew, blowing past the per-user quota. The fix serializes refreshes and tightens the window. The quota and timing knobs that make this safe are set below.

tuning constants:
QUOTAS = {
    "druwyn": 5,
    "holix": 5,
    "zorath": 5,
    "holwyn": 10,
}

# Break-Glass: Catalog Cache Invalidation

Scope: the Pinrow product catalog at Veldstone Retail. If stale prices persist after a purge and the Hollowmere invalidation queue is wedged, use break-glass to flush the edge tier directly. Contractors: get verbal sign-off from the catalog lead first. Steps: open the Hollowmere admin shell, select emergency-flush, confirm the tenant, and run it once — repeated flushes thrash the origin. Access is logged and expires after 20 minutes. Unseal the admin shell with the passphrase below.

recovery phrase for kahop-tajog: istix-casvan